摘要:通信專業考試互聯網技術MN的移動:MIPv6定義了使用IPv6鄰居發現功能(包括路由器發現和鄰居不可達檢測)來進行移動檢測的機制。MN也應該利用其他倌息對這種機制進行補充。
1.MN的移動
MN的移動檢測
MIPv6定義了使用IPv6鄰居發現功能(包括路由器發現和鄰居不可達檢測)來進行移動檢測的機制。MN也應該利用其他倌息對這種機制進行補充。
MN應該使用鄰居發現來發現新的路由器和子網前綴,MN可以發送路由器請求,也可以等待主動的路由器通告。基于接收到的路出器通告,MN在其默認路由表中為每一個路由器維持一個條目,也在前綴列表中為它當前認為的每個子網前綴維護一個條目?這些表中的每個條目都有一個生存期。當MN離家時,它會選擇一個默認路由器和一個要使用的子網前綴作為它的首要轉交地址的前綴。
當MN離家時,MN能夠快速檢測到其先前的默認路由器不可達是十分必要的。當這種事情發生時,MN應該轉到一個新的畎認路由器,并得到一個新的首要轉交地址。另一方面,如果MN從它的馱認路由器變得不可達,它應該嘗試用其他路由器變得可達。為檢測何時它的馱認路由器變得不可達,MN應該使用鄰居不可達檢測。
因為路由器應該周期地發送主動路由器通告,MN有機會檢査它的默認路由器是否可達,甚至在它沒有收到該路由器轉發的包的時候也能夠做到這一點?若MN收到的路由器通告中包含通告間隔選項,MN可以使用通告間隔域中的值作為它所希望路由器隨后發出的通告的頻率。這個域包含MN希望的最小間隔。如果在這個間隔之后,MN仍然未收到來自這個路由器的通告,MN就確信上--個通告丟失了#因而對MN來說,執行自己的策略是可能的,這種策略用以確定MN在決定換一個路由器之前所能容忍的當前默認路由器丟失的最大通告數。
如果上面的方法不能提供關于MN依舊從當前畎認路由器可達的指示(如MN在一段時間內未從路由器收到包),那么MN就應該嘗試用鄰居請求對路由器進行探測,若MN收到回應,則路由器是依舊可達的。對某些類型的網絡來說,關丁鏈路層移動的指示可以通過鏈路層協議或MN的設備驅動軟件獲得。例如,MN從一個蜂窩小區到另一個的移動等。
返回目錄:
編輯特別推薦:
通信工程師備考資料免費領取
去領取
專注在線職業教育25年